Output 89e66327ee418bd7b184b868db5123087e9441a7836f4bfe921422ba74cf5b1a:4

value
335917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bfd67d61df1f633d1eaa0ab7fb5d07297a335df OP_EQUAL
address
3FupED1v8Dr2hrT13AXUQ6ShXFNgm2Ctnp
transaction
89e66327ee418bd7b184b868db5123087e9441a7836f4bfe921422ba74cf5b1a
confirmations
303732
spent
true